Brochu helps Jr. Thunder snap skid

Eight-point game from Bryce Brochu gets Langley junior lacrosse club back in win column

Three goals and eight points from Bryce Brochu helped the Langley Jr. Thunder snap a four-game winless streak.

The Thunder defeated the Burnaby Junior Lakers 13-10 at the Langley Events Centre.

Langley scored six of the first eight goals and led 13-4 early in the third period. The Lakers scored scored six goals — including four on the power play in a span of 4:11 — in the final period but ran out of time in their comeback attempt.

Dylan Lacroix (three goals, one assist), James Rahe (two goals, three assists), Ryan Martel (two goals), Thomas Moffatt (one goal, two assists) and Alex Gibbs (four assists) also had multi-point games.

Brodie Porter and Parker Willis had the other Langley goals and Jake Sunder stopped 39 shots for the win.

The victory came on the heels of a 12-7 loss the night before in Coquitlam to the Junior Adanacs.

Rahe had five goals in the losing cause while Moffatt had a goal and four helpers. Christian Bosa had the other Langley goal while Gibbs and Lacroix had three assists apiece and Brochu chipped in with a pair of helpers.

The Thunder (2-3-1) host the Victoria Junior Shamrocks (3-2) on Sunday (May 17) at the LEC. Game time is 5 p.m.
